18 /** \class SPDocument
19 * SPDocument serves as the container of both model trees (agnostic XML
20 * and typed object tree), and implements all of the document-level
21 * functionality used by the program. Many document level operations, like
22 * load, save, print, export and so on, use SPDocument as their basic datatype.
23 *
24 * SPDocument implements undo and redo stacks and an id-based object
25 * dictionary. Thanks to unique id attributes, the latter can be used to
26 * map from the XML tree back to the object tree.
27 *
28 * SPDocument performs the basic operations needed for asynchronous
29 * update notification (SPObject ::modified virtual method), and implements
30 * the 'modified' signal, as well.
31 */
